A humorous collection of poems covers a wide array of bizarre topics, from Mamie Eisenhower in love to the poet's own battle against amphetamines.

With his brother, Joel, Ethan Coen has produced, written, and directed films such as Raising Arizona, Miller’s Crossing, The Hudsucker Proxy, The Big Lebowski, and O Brother, Where Art Thou? Their latest film is The Man Who Wasn’t There. Ethan’s first book, a collection of short stories, is <b>Gates of Eden.</b>
